Chromium crashes when 'Load Media Router Component Extension' is enabled, but cannot cast without it

Reported by mbwdo...@gmail.com, May 11 2018

Issue description

UserAgent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ows NT 10.0; Win64; x64; rv:57.0) Gecko/20100101 Firefox/57.0

Steps to reproduce the problem:
1. chrome://flags>enable 'Load Media Router Component Extension' 
2. start Chromium 
3. 

What is the expected behavior?
Chromium starts with 'Load Media Router Component Extension' enabled

What went wrong?
Chromium crashes with 'Load Media Router Component Extension' enabled.

Chromium will NOT cast without this extension enabled.  The cast window will display "No cast destinations found." 

So there is no way to cast using Chromium without it crashing.

WebStore page: n/a

Did this work before? Yes unknown

Chrome version: Chromium 65.0.3325.181 Fedora Project  Channel: stable
OS Version: 28
Flash Version: Disabled

This appears to be a known issue at least on the debian side (https://askubuntu.com/questions/932016/chromium-crashes-as-soon-as-i-log-in; https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=882698).  But whatever fixes were implemented did not remedy it.  Casting cannot be performed in Chromium without ''Load Media Router Component Extension' and enabling ''Load Media Router Component Extension' crashes the browser.

Unable to reproduce the issue on ubuntu 17.10 using chrome reported version #65.0.3325.181 (Official Build) Built on Ubuntu , running on Ubuntu 17.10 (64-bit) and stable #66.0.3359.139.

Attached a screen cast for reference.

Following are the steps followed to reproduce the issue.
------------
1. chrome://flags>enable 'Load Media Router Component Extension' 
2. started Chromium 
3. Observed that Chromium starts with 'Load Media Router Component Extension' enabled as expected.
As the issue seems to be reproducible on debian. Hence, forwarding the issue to inhouse team for further triaging of the issue.
